About the name Nelcia
Nelcia is a feminine given name derived from the Latin root "nel" or related to Cornelia, ultimately tracing to the Roman family name Cornelius, meaning "horn" or "horned." The name emerged as a variant form combining Latin roots with the feminine suffix "-ia."
The name has been used primarily in English-speaking and European Christian cultures, with particular presence in Portuguese and Spanish-speaking communities; it lacks significant historical prominence in major religious texts or ancient records, making it largely a modern creation or regional variant.

Nelcia currently ranks #6,278 in the United States as a girl's name. It reached its peak popularity around 1977.
